The video discusses the 'motherhood penalty,' highlighting how mothers' earnings decrease after childbirth, unlike fathers. It emphasizes that motherhood can enhance work efficiency and task management skills. Mothers often become better at prioritizing tasks and making strong commitments. The video encourages recognizing and leveraging these strengths in the workplace.
